| The Hefeng 25 variety with low seed VE content in Heilongjiang province and the Bayfield variety with high seed VE content in Canada were crossed.144 F2:7 recombinant inbred lines (RILs) were as materials. Theα,γ-andδ-tocopherol content and the total VE content were tested by HPLC in three places. The relativity were analysised between agronomic traits andα-,γ-andδ-tocopherolcontent and the total VE content of soybean in three places. The rules of inheritance of VE content (α-,γ-andδ-tocopherolcontent) in soybean powder were analysised by the major and multiple genes mixed genetic model. The genetic linkage mapping of soybean VE was constructed. The QTL were identified in theα-,γ-andδ-tocopherol content and the total VE content of soybean. And the QTL were identified in the agronomic traits in soybean. The interval of the QTL was fine QTL. The soybean variety was marker-assisted selected in the interval of the QTL was refined QTL. The results were as follows:1. Theα,γ-andδ-tocopherol content and the total VE content were tested in three places by HPLC. The method was simple and fit to test the VE content. Compare theα-,γ-andδ-tocopherol content and the total VE content in three places. The results were that a-tocopherol content and the total VE content in Haerbin were higher than those of the VE content in Hulan and Suihua.There were the relativity between the agronomic traits and protein, fat and theα-,γ-andδ-tocopherol content and the total VE content of soybean. It was significance that the VE variety was cultivated by screening the agronomic traits and protein, fat.2. Theα-tocopherol content was affected better than the y-and 8-tocopherol content by the environment by the genetic mechanism of vitamin E in the soybean.3. The QTL were identified in theα-,γ-andδ-tocopherol content and the total VE content of soybean seeds. The linkage group of the D1b was found in the three places. The linkage groups of the N, A2 and L were found in the two places.4. The fine QTL of soybean vitamin E was identified in the interval between the Sat239 and the Satt022 on the N linkage group. The polymorphism that was the primers was found in parents. It was valuable to divide the interval into little interval to the MAS.5. There were seven major QTLs about vitamin E in soybean. MAS related vitamin E in soybean was carried out in the intervals between the sat239 and satt022. Considering the all kinds of the agronomic traits, six strains which were good in the yield and quality about soybean VE were screened out. Their number was the 4,54,104,114,122,135. |
